Abstract
A 2.4-GHz meander-line antenna printed on a USB-WLAN card is presented for WLAN applications. The HFSS 3-D EM simulator is employed for design simulation. The printed meander-line antenna is realized on a FR-4 PCB substrate. The measured VSWR is less than 2 from 2.4 to 2.5 GHz. Besides different orientations, the meander-line antenna printed on a simulated USB-WLAN card was attached to the side wall of a notebook-PC to investigate the PC housing effects on the antenna radiation patterns.
